29 CFR 1926.501(b)(13): Each employee(s) engaged in residential construction activities 6 feet (1.8 m) or more above lower levels were not protected by guardrail systems, safety net system, or personal fall arrest system, nor were employee(s) provided with an alternative fall protection measure under another provision of paragraph 1926.501 (b):       a)  On or about 10/05/15, on the steep roof of a house at 33 Mill St., Williamsville, NY:  An employee was exposed to a potential  fall of  approx.  30 ft. to the ground while on a steep roof doing masonry work on a chimney.  The employee was wearing a full body harness, but was not tethered to anything.  No  other fall protection system was utilized to protect the employee.    b)  On or about 10/05/15, on the flat roof section at the southeast part of the house at 33 Mill St., Williamsville, NY:  An employee was exposed to a potential  fall of 10 ft. 10 in. to the ground while on the flat roof , then climbed a ladder to supply a container of concrete to the employee working on the chimney.   No fall protection system was utilized to protect the employee.     NO ABATEMENT CERTIFICATION REQUIRED

29 CFR 1926.1051(a): Stairway(s) or ladder(s) were not provided at all personnel points of access where there was a break in elevation of 19 inches (48 cm) or more, or no ramp, runway, sloped embankment, or personnel hoist was provided:      a)  On or about 10/05/15, at the house at 33 Mill St., Williamsville, NY:  An employee accessed the flat roof section at the southeast part of the house by climbing a scaffold section,  walking north towards the house on a single scaffold pik, then hoisting himself  up backwards  a distance of 3 ft. to the lower roof, exposing himself to a potential  fall of  approx.  8 ft. to the  ground .  No ladder or other proper means of access to the lower roof was provided.       NO ABATEMENT CERTIFICATION REQUIRED
